How long have you been a part of EasyRecycle?
Since 1998, I have been involved with IT equipment. In 2011, I founded the company in collaboration with my brother, Danni, and my father, Svend-Erik. We saw potential in the industry and had a strong passion for circular economy and sustainability. Today, I have a close management collaboration with Danni.
